AstatenateZ 09-15-2017 02:29 PM

http://i1383.photobucket.com/albums/...psl2qyokvf.jpg

Got my harnesses installed (I know the track nazis are going to tell me this is unsafe) using my OEM seat. I just wanted to show it's possible. I have the shoulder straps under the carpet to the cross member of the frame. Welded an i-Bolt and attached the shoulder harnesses mounts. The bottoms I removed seat and track and installed a universal mounting bar from Sparco and connected the lap straps down! Very comfy and locked up the brakes a few times to see. Definitely going to need some comfort pads but it does it's job and doesn't slide or let me go anywhere. Feels a lot more assuring. Bonus: it looks cool :tup:

Can I ask what paint ran you on the bumper(s)?

AstatenateZ 02-22-2018 02:14 PM

Quote:

Originally Posted by nismoZium (Post 3732362)
Can I ask what paint ran you on the bumper(s)?

I paid my paint guy $150 per bumper ($300 total) for painting. $80 for a QT of good PPG paint. And probably $40-50 in supplies (sand papers, scotch pads, adhesion promoter, cleaning supplies) so right at about $400 for all

I do all my own prepping and finishing. So he just paints them and does the work in between coats of paints. Like fine sanding and taping / masking off.

I do the first prep. And I also do the final wet sanding and buffing myself. So it saves me a lot of $$$
